Brindley Books Ticket To Final

Fish’O’Mania’s fifteenth qualifier made its way south to the marvellous Makins Fishery. This qualifier using lakes on both Phases 1 and 2 promised so much, but once again massive changes in the weather, combined with the fish still in a spawning mood, suppressed catches.

On the day an almost wintry wind just made things all the more difficult for the majority. That said, there were a fair number of really good weights spread across the whole complex.

It was local Nuneaton -based angler, Steve Brindley, fishing peg 39 on Lake 5 who sorted out a run of quality fish to 6lbs, fishing banded 6mm pellets short who took top honours with 120lbs 12ozs.

In second spot was Ian Fisk from Burnley who put an impressive 105 lbs 1oz on the scales at peg 16 on Lizard Pool. Ian also fished 6mm pellet and caught fish to 9lbs.

Andy Power, having made the long trek from Somerset, captured third with 102lb 12oz from peg 29 also on Lizard. Andy took carp to 11lbs fishing shallow with banded pellet on long pole then later took more fish short and down the edge on meat.

Warren Martin put the fourth ton weight on the scales at peg 34 on Lake 5 weighing 101lbs 2oz and Sam Brown took fish to 10lbs from peg 25 on Lake 4 to total 84lbs 12ozs.
